2-3. INDOOR UNIT PREPARATION
Remove the front panel of the indoor unit.
1) Push the 2 locations marked "PUSH" on the upper part of the front grille until a
"click" is heard.
2) Open the front grille toward you.
3) Remove the 2 screws.
4) Grasp the rear horizontal vane at the upper air outlet, and open it.
5) Push the 3 locations on the top of the front panel, and then pull the upper part
of the front panel toward you.
6) Remove the front panel while lifting it up (slightly).
* The front panel can be removed without opening the damper of the lower air
outlet.
